VO2 Max Testing

The VO2 max test is considered the gold-standard measure of your fitness level. It is a functional test that measures the maximum amount of oxygen that your body can utilize when undergoing strenuous exercise. Numerous large population studies have shown that the VO2 max score predicts all-cause mortality better than traditional markers such as smoking, hypertension, and even a diagnosis of heart disease or diabetes.

At Valley Healthspan, we offer direct VO2 max testing using a bicycle ergometer (a stationary exercise bike) with the Korr CardioCoach®. After a 10 minute warm-up on the bicycle, the workload is gradually increased until maximal exertion is reached, after which the patient completes a 3-5 minute cool-down period. The test typically takes 20-25 minutes total.

The CardioCoach® uses Anaerobic Threshold and VO2 Max results to define workouts zones unique to each patients. These results can be uploaded to the CardioCoach® app to guide you through workouts for cardio-strengthening, endurance, weight loss or other goals custom designed for you.
